Understanding the Appeal Alright folks, before we get too deep into the specifics of
Costco Canada silver bars
, let’s hit pause for a sec and talk about the ‘why.’ Why are people, perhaps even you, suddenly eyeing
silver
as an investment? Well, the truth is, silver has a
dual appeal
that makes it incredibly attractive to a diverse range of investors. First off, it’s often seen as a
safe haven asset
, much like its shinier cousin, gold. During times of economic uncertainty, geopolitical turmoil, or when inflation starts to rear its ugly head, investors tend to flock to tangible assets like silver. Why? Because unlike fiat currencies, which can be printed endlessly, silver has a
finite supply
. This inherent scarcity gives it a stability that many paper assets simply can’t match, acting as a powerful hedge against inflation and a store of value when traditional markets are in flux. It offers a tangible sense of security, allowing you to
hold a piece of real wealth
that isn’t reliant on a bank’s ledger or a government’s promise. Many smart individuals are looking to
diversify their portfolios
, and including precious metals like silver is a classic strategy to spread risk and potentially boost long-term returns. It’s not just about what happens when things go wrong, either; silver also has a strong case for growth! Beyond its role as a monetary metal,
silver
is an
industrial powerhouse
. Think about it: it’s crucial for everything from solar panels and electric vehicles to medical devices, electronics, and even water purification systems. As the world pushes towards green energy and advanced technology, the demand for industrial silver is only projected to
skyrocket
. This means that while gold primarily serves as a monetary asset and a luxury item, silver benefits from both investment demand
and
surging industrial consumption. This unique combination makes it a rather
dynamic investment
, capable of performing well in both bull and bear markets, albeit with higher volatility than gold due to its smaller market size. For those of you looking for assets with significant upside potential tied to global technological advancements and economic development,
investing in silver
presents a compelling argument. It’s truly a metal of the past, present, and future, maintaining its value across millennia while simultaneously powering the innovations of tomorrow. So, when you’re considering
Costco Canada silver bars
, you’re not just buying a shiny collectible; you’re investing in a material with profound economic significance and a rich history, positioning yourself strategically in a world that increasingly values both stability and technological progress. Understanding these fundamental drivers is key to appreciating the true value of your potential silver holdings.## Navigating Costco’s Silver Bar Offerings in Canada Alright, now that we’re all hyped about the ‘why’ of
silver investment
, let’s get down to the ‘how’—specifically, how to score some of those gleaming
silver bars at Costco Canada
. This isn’t your grandma’s Costco run, guys; it’s a unique retail experience for precious metals. The first thing you need to understand is that Costco’s inventory, especially for high-demand items like
silver bars
, can be quite
dynamic and often limited
. Availability isn’t always a guarantee, and when they do drop, these items tend to sell out incredibly fast, sometimes within minutes! Typically,
Costco Canada
offers silver bars primarily through their
online platform
, Costco.ca. While it’s rare to find them regularly stocked in physical warehouses, checking online is always your best bet. Keep a close eye on their website, as new shipments and offerings usually appear without much fanfare. You’ll often find popular sizes like
1-ounce
and
10-ounce silver bars
, sometimes even larger
100-ounce bars
, from reputable mints like the Royal Canadian Mint (RCM) or other well-known refiners such as PAMP Suisse, Valcambi, or Sunshine Minting. The purity is almost always
.999 fine silver
or better, which is the industry standard for investment-grade bullion. It’s crucial to confirm the
mint and purity
before making any purchase, although Costco typically partners with trusted names, ensuring authenticity and quality. One of the
biggest appeals
of buying
silver bars at Costco Canada
is the perception of competitive pricing, often hovering just slightly above the
spot price
of silver, which can be attractive compared to specialized bullion dealers who might have higher premiums. However, remember that pricing can fluctuate rapidly with the market, so what seems like a great deal one day might be different the next. It’s also important to note that you usually need an
active Costco membership
to make these purchases, and some transactions might be subject to purchasing limits, especially for high-value items like precious metals. Payment methods are usually restricted to debit cards, some credit cards, or specific Costco payment options, and it’s always wise to check their current policies on their website or with customer service. from your favorite bulk retailer!## The Cost Factor: Pricing and Value at Costco Canada Let’s talk brass tacks, or should I say,
silver facts
: the
cost of silver bars at Costco Canada
is a huge part of the appeal for many investors, but it’s essential to understand the nuances of pricing and true value. When you’re looking at
silver bars
, the immediate benchmark is the
spot price
of silver, which is the current market price for one ounce of silver for immediate delivery. However, when you purchase physical silver, whether from Costco or a specialized dealer, you’ll always pay a
premium
over this spot price. This premium covers manufacturing, shipping, insurance, and the dealer’s margin. What makes
Costco Canada
often stand out is that their premiums tend to be
among the lowest
in the retail market, especially for well-known brands and standard sizes like 1-ounce or 10-ounce bars. This competitive pricing is a major draw for members looking to acquire tangible assets without significant markups, making
Costco silver bars
a highly sought-after commodity. However, don’t just look at the raw price tag; consider the overall value proposition. While Costco’s premiums can be lower, their
silver bar
offerings are usually limited in variety compared to dedicated bullion dealers, and as we discussed, availability can be sporadic. Dedicated bullion dealers might offer a wider selection of mints, sizes, and product types (like rounds or coins), and they often provide more robust services like secure storage solutions or buy-back programs, which Costco generally doesn’t. So, when evaluating the
cost
, think about what’s included beyond the silver itself. With Costco, you’re primarily getting the benefit of their
bulk purchasing power
and efficient supply chain, which translates into lower premiums directly to you. Payment methods also play a role in the total cost. Typically, purchases made with debit cards or bank transfers might avoid additional credit card processing fees that some bullion dealers charge. For
Costco Canada
, you’ll use their standard payment methods, so be sure to check if using a specific credit card might offer cash back or points that could subtly reduce your effective
cost of silver bars
. It’s also crucial to monitor the
silver market
closely. Prices for precious metals can fluctuate hourly, even by the minute. A seemingly great deal at Costco might lose some luster if the spot price drops significantly shortly after your purchase. Conversely, you could quickly see gains if the market moves upward. for wealth preservation and potential growth. Remember, research and market awareness are your best friends in this journey!## Essential Tips for Buying Silver Bars at Costco Alright, guys, you’re almost ready to dive into the exciting world of
Costco Canada silver bars
! But before you hit that ‘add to cart’ button, let’s arm you with some crucial tips to ensure your purchase is not just successful, but also
smart and secure
. Think of these as your personal cheat sheet for navigating the unique landscape of buying precious metals from a major retailer. First and foremost,
do your research diligently
. While Costco is a reputable retailer, it’s always wise to confirm the specific product details for any
silver bar
you’re considering. Check the mint, the purity (it should ideally be .999 fine silver or higher), and the weight. Look up reviews, not just for the product, but for the overall experience of buying bullion from Costco if available. Knowing what you’re buying inside and out helps you verify authenticity upon arrival. This deep dive into product specifics can prevent future headaches and ensure you’re getting exactly what you intended for your investment portfolio. Next up,
stay vigilant for availability and act quickly
. As we’ve mentioned,
Costco Canada silver bars
are notorious for selling out fast. These aren’t regular inventory items you can casually pick up anytime. They often appear with little notice and disappear just as fast. Consider setting up email alerts or following online forums dedicated to bullion deals where members share real-time updates on Costco’s drops. Having your membership details and payment information ready can save you crucial seconds when these precious metals become available. It’s truly a ‘blink and you miss it’ scenario sometimes, so preparedness is your best friend here. Furthermore,
consider secure storage solutions
before
your
silver bars
even arrive. Unlike other Costco purchases, these are high-value, tangible assets that require proper safekeeping. Are you planning to use a home safe, a safety deposit box at a bank, or a specialized third-party vault storage service? Each option has its pros and cons in terms of accessibility, cost, and insurance. Whatever you choose, ensure it’s secure, discreet, and ideally insured. Don’t underestimate the importance of this step; securing your physical assets is just as critical as acquiring them. Lastly,
understand the market and plan for the future
. While buying
silver bars
can be exciting, it’s an investment. Keep an eye on the
spot price of silver
and broader economic trends. This awareness helps you understand the value of your holdings over time and can inform future buying or selling decisions. Be realistic about potential gains and losses, as the market can be volatile. Also, remember that when it comes time to sell, you’ll typically sell to a dedicated bullion dealer, not back to Costco. Research these dealers and their buy-back premiums in advance so you’re not caught off guard. By following these essential tips, you’re not just making a purchase; you’re making a
